22 JULY, OSLO, NORWAY: THE SOCIETY INVESTIGATE ITSELF THE CASE OF BREIVIK ATTACK
description The existing research is a monitoring study, deals with the media representation of Breivik terror attack in Norvegian media, which caused death of 77 people on 22th of July, 2011. The research applied content analysis to the news headlines and comments of selected 3 popular and serious newspapers -Aftenposten, Dagbladet and Verdens Gang (VG)- which were published between 22 July-01 August in order to understand how Breivik case was represented in the news coverage. Furthermore, as targeting an extensive analysis, existing study also applied a frame analysis to find out which aspects of the Breivik attack were covered in the media. In the framework of the study the tracks of societal discourse caused by Breivik case were analysed within the Norwegian media. The content and headlines of 1643 news items which were published between (22 July -22 November) were analysed and furthermore it was applied framework analysis of 34 news items which were appeared in the selected newspapers. The political parties, right-wing politicians, muslims in Norway were actors of the discourses. The findings of the study reveals the fact that it is possible to dominate terror related event with the discourse of democracy, tolerance, love and openness. As a young Labour Youth Party politician, Helle Gannestad, stated “If one man can generate so much evil, imagine how much love we together can create.” The Norwegian society and the media represent a unique example to the whole world by handling and reacting the existing terror attack.
